A blue line means an edge which is only connected to 1 poly. If you've got another blue line, IN THE SAME MESH, like this:
__________
[__________]

__________
[__________]

Select both edges, and press the right mouse button on, or close to them.

The dark blue lines means those edges are hard. You use that when you want the edge to be noticed to make a 'crease' sort of thing the model. It's pretty useful if you want your model to look not so round and smooth.
